Storosnova (In Storosnovan: Стороснова), officially known as the Gothburg Empire of Storosnova, is a country located in the central region of Ostlandet. Situated south of the Ocean Acernis, Storosnova borders Baltanla to the northeast, Saratov to the south-west, Syntsi to the southeast. The country covers an area of 1,959,248 square kilometers (756,470 square miles), making it the 15th largest country in the world. Erika is the capital and the largest city in the country, with other important cities including North City, Gran Glorian, Sofia and Ruse. Storosnova is a semi-constitutional monarchy governed almost entirely by the Storosnova parliament, with most of the authority resting with the monarch. The Empire is composed of six principalities, with the main one being the Principality of Erika, where the imperial capital is located. The remaining five are North, Altan, Rush Valley, Resembool and Gran Glorian. Storosnova has a population of 80 million. Storosnova is a member of the TNC, an interest member of CODECO and a member of the OU. The current monarch is Tzar Boris IV and the Prime Minister is James Sammut.

History

Prehistory (1.8 million BC — 5000 BC)

Human remains unearthed in the Luminara caves, dating approximately 1.8 million years ago, mark the onset of human presence in the region.

The first settlements in Storosnova date back to 5,500 BC, with the Neolithic structures of Astralara being one of the oldest known human constructions. By the end of the Neolithic era, the Karankia, Hamanova, and Selestiya cultures thrived, extending beyond Storosnova into neighboring territories. The region's first known city, Radiantopolis, stood as a beacon of civilization in the Storosnova area.

Around 4,800 BC, Storosnova's neolithic era witnessed the rise of the Aetherian culture, characterized by a sophisticated social hierarchy. The epicenter of this civilization was the Eclipsara Necropolis, discovered in the early 19th century.

Grape cultivation and livestock domestication are milestones associated with Aetherian culture in the Bronze Age. Cave paintings in the Karo and Novos caves, though the exact years of their creation remain a mystery, depict the interaction between ancient inhabitants and the nature of their environment.

Ancient era (5000 BC — 434 AD)

Around 5000 BC, a group of Slavic peoples known as Storosnovans migrated from the south of Ostlandet for the region that today corresponds to Storosnova. The exact reasons of this imigration remain unknown, but it is speculated that it may be related to climate changes, demographic pressure or in search of fertile lands. Upon arriving in the region, the Storosnovans came into contact with the Aetherian people. The Storosnovans carried out raids and pillages against the Aetherians; at times, these confrontations evolved into more extensive conquests, with the Storosnovans taking control of Aetherian territories. Over time, the Storosnovans gradually assimilated a large part of the Aetherian population. This process of assimilation contributed to the formation of a hybrid identity. From this cultural fusion, the Storosnovans established tribal kingdoms, marking the beginning of a more structured political organization.

In 257 AD, the Despotate of Aetheria arose and soon managed to conquer most of the other Storosnovan tribes. From 300 AD onwards, the Despotate began to become more authoritarian and oppressive. In 325, a woman appeared commanding an army against Aetheria, her name was Erika of Gothburg, not sure where Gothburg was or if it was a city that was destroyed by the Aetherians. Erika led several revolts and several victories in battle, reports from the time say that she was sent by God to free the Storosnovans, in 334 in an important battle where the Despot died and Aetheria fell, that same year Erika was crowned queen of the Kingdom of Gothburg and nicknamed The Founder.
